China Datang Corporation was founded on Dec 29, 2002 on the basis of some of the enterprises and public institutions under the former State Power Corporation of China. One of the large-scale power generation companies in China, it is a centrally-administered and wholly state-owned company. It is also a State Council-approved institution set up with state-authorized investment and pilot state-controlled company, with registered capital of more than 18 billion yuan ($2.61 billion).

Main business: Management of all state-owned assets in the corporation and related enterprises; development of electrical energy, investment,construction, operation and management; electricity (thermal power) generation and sales; manufacturing, repair, maintenance and testing of power systems; R & D of power technology and consulting service; contracting of electrical engineering and related environmental protection projects while offering consultation service in this field; new energy development; electricity-related coal resource development and production; import and export of various products and technologies as well as agent service in these regards; contracting of overseas projects and international tendering projects in China; export of equipment and materials required by the aforesaid overseas projects; and labor dispatch service for overseas projects.

China Datang Corporation adopts a governance system and operation model on the basis of a three-tier organizational structure encompassing the corporation, branch (subsidiary) companies, and grassroots enterprises. It has set up 13 provincial power generation companies, including those in Hebei, Jilin, Heilongjiang, Jiangsu and Anhui provinces, six branch companies in Hunan, Guangxi, Shanxi, Tibet, Shanghai and Ningxia, and specialized companies such as Datang Electric Power Fuel Co.

Presently, China Datang Corporation owns five listed companies – Datang International Power Generation Co, the first Chinese company listed in London and the first power company listed in Hong Kong; Datang Huayin Electric Power Co and Guangxi Guiguan Electric Power Co, two of the earliest domestically-listed companies; the Hong Kong-listed China Datang Corporation Renewable Power Co and Datang Environment Industry Group Co. Datang owns Inner Mongolia Datang International Tuoketuo Power Generation Co, China’s largest thermal power plant in operation, as well as Datang Saihanba Wind Farm in Chifeng, Inner Mongolia, the world’s largest wind farm in operation. It also owns the Longtan Hydropower Station, one of China’s biggest hydropower stations, and China National Water Resources & Electric Power Materials & Equipment Co, which has logistic networks covering the whole country. Datang has made the list of Fortune Global 500 companies for eight consecutive years since 2010.
